The three types of business entities are a sole proprietorship, a partnership, and a corporation. A sole proprietorship is owned by one person, a partnership is owned by two or more people, and a corporation is a business entity separate from its owners.
A partnership is a venture by two or more people. A merger is when the owners of two businesses agree to join their firms together to make one business

With a proprietorship, a business owner can make decisions quicker. In a partnership, the owners have to come to a consensus, which can take a lot of time.
